Output 21b59227f785c534985e6716e87b285b29b83e756ac58947f23a8035e9eeb6bf:61

value
46499582
script pubkey
OP_0 OP_PUSHBYTES_20 adfe0e206a675163918b5b28c6744e85ef5dc8e4
address
bc1q4hlqugr2vagk8yvttv5vvazwshh4mj8y9jsc5k
transaction
21b59227f785c534985e6716e87b285b29b83e756ac58947f23a8035e9eeb6bf
spent
true